Still do............after the driver hiatus between
53.03 ( 9 Dec 2003) and 56.72 ( latest official, 1 April 2004)
The ones between are best forgotten. nVidia did a run-time
compiler update after 53.03 that broke a lot of stuff, but
seem to have got it all back together again with 56.72.
Very stable indeed. Unlikely to be OFFICIALLY updated
until some of the new 6800 stuff is properly integrated.
The 6800 is surviving on beta Detonator drivers at the
moment, which nVidia has seen prudent not to officially
foist on the rest of their graphics-card families. Of course,
the beta 6800 drivers have been leaked and tried out
on non-6800 cards.
